Creative Consultant
Robofilms, Inc.
June 1998 – July 2001 (3 years 2 months)
Helped create, co-found, design, implement, and market one of the earliest Flash-based online-video-sharing websites in the world. Basically, we invented YouTube before YouTube. Except that at the time almost no one had high-speed Internet and a lot of people didn't even have the Flash plug-in installed on their browsers -- so the world just wasn't ready for a high-bandwidth Flash-based streaming-video site. And then we ran out of money and the site folded, while the real YouTube later sold for $1.65 billion. Such is life!
